    6. QUIT TRYING TO BE TRENDY WITH HDR

    HDR does not equal awesome photo. Theres times to use it and times not to and just properly expose your photo. Taking a multiple exposures of your Accord in your parents driveway then tossing into photomatix is a perfect example of a time not to use HDR. Nothing pisses me off more than people trying to look cool by "shooting an HDR".
